Start With Settings And Operating Basics
A surprising number of mini split cooling problems come down to a simple issue: the unit is not actually in cooling mode, the set temperature is not low enough, or the fan setting is preventing proper cooling. Because mini splits use inverter technology, they often ramp up and down gradually. That can make a small setting mistake look like a bigger failure. Before you open covers or think about repairs, confirm the basics and give the system time to respond.
Another common scenario is a power interruption or breaker reset that changes behavior. Some systems have built in compressor protection delays. You might hear the indoor fan, but cooling does not start immediately. If mini split cooling problems began after an outage, start by resetting your expectations and confirming a stable cooling command.
Confirm Cool Mode, Setpoint, And Fan Setting
Set the unit to Cool mode, lower the temperature at least 3 to 5 degrees below room temperature, and select Auto fan or a medium fan speed. Then wait 10 to 15 minutes. Mini splits do not always blow icy air instantly because they modulate. If the unit begins cooling but feels weak, continue down the checklist.
Quick Checklist
- Mode: Cool
- Set temperature: below room temperature
- Fan: Auto or medium
- Swing: On for better distribution
- Doors and windows: closed
Check For A Time Delay After Restart
If the compressor does not start right away, the system may be protecting itself. Leave it on in Cool mode and avoid switching modes rapidly. Rapid cycling can create additional mini split cooling problems by confusing the control logic and stressing components. If cooling does not start within 15 minutes, move to airflow checks.
Airflow Issues That Cause Weak Cooling
Airflow is one of the biggest drivers of mini split cooling problems. The indoor unit must pull warm room air through a filter and across a cold coil. If airflow is restricted, the system cannot remove enough heat. Airflow restriction can also cause coil icing, which further reduces cooling and can lead to dripping water once the ice melts.
Many airflow problems are easy to fix. Dirty filters, blocked vents, and furniture blocking the discharge path are the most common. In bedrooms, heavy curtains can partially cover the indoor unit without you noticing. In living spaces, tall cabinets or shelves placed too close can disrupt circulation.
Dirty Filters Are A Top Cause
A clogged filter is one of the most common mini split cooling problems, especially in homes with pets, renovations, or high outdoor pollen. Remove the filter, clean it per manufacturer instructions, let it dry completely, and reinstall. While the filter is out, check for visible dust buildup on the coil surface. If the coil is heavily clogged, that may require professional cleaning.
Signs Filters Are The Issue
- Weak airflow from the indoor unit
- Room stays warm even though the unit runs
- Musty or dusty smells
- Indoor unit sounds louder than usual
Blocked Air Discharge Or Return Air
Mini split cooling problems can also happen when airflow is physically blocked. Make sure the front discharge area is clear and the return intake is not obstructed. Avoid placing furniture directly under the unit in a way that forces air to bounce back. Keep curtains and drapes from covering the indoor unit’s intake or discharge.
Easy Fixes
- Move furniture away from the airflow path
- Pull curtains back from the indoor head
- Open interior doors if you are trying to cool adjacent spaces
Outdoor Unit Issues That Prevent Cooling
A mini split works by moving heat from inside to outside. If the outdoor unit cannot reject heat properly, mini split cooling problems show up indoors as weak or inconsistent cooling. Outdoor units need airflow through the coil and a functioning fan. If debris blocks the coil, if the fan is not running, or if the unit is buried behind stored items, cooling performance drops fast.
Outdoor conditions also matter. During heat waves, the system works harder. If the outdoor unit is already restricted by debris or poor placement, you may notice mini split cooling problems only on the hottest afternoons. That does not mean the unit is fine. It often means the system is operating near its limit and needs maintenance.
Check Outdoor Clearance And Coil Cleanliness
Visually inspect the outdoor unit. Remove leaves, weeds, or objects that block airflow. Ensure you have open space around the unit so it can breathe. If the coil is dirty, gentle cleaning with low pressure water can help. Avoid high pressure sprays because they can bend fins and worsen airflow.
Symptoms Of Outdoor Airflow Problems
- Cooling is weaker during the hottest part of the day
- Outdoor unit is very hot to the touch
- Fan sounds strained or inconsistent
- System runs long hours without reaching set temperature
Outdoor Fan Not Running Properly
If the outdoor fan is not running, heat cannot be expelled effectively. This can cause serious mini split cooling problems. The issue might be an electrical fault, a motor problem, or a control issue. This is not a DIY repair. If the outdoor unit is not running normally, it is time to call a professional.
Frozen Coils And Icing Problems
When the indoor coil freezes, the system loses heat transfer ability. A frozen coil is one of the most visible mini split cooling problems, and it is often caused by low airflow, dirty filters, or refrigerant issues. If you see frost or ice, do not keep forcing cooling. Switch the unit to fan mode and let it thaw.
After thawing, clean filters and confirm airflow is strong. If icing returns quickly, that is a sign of deeper issues. Continued icing can lead to water leaks, damage to components, and ongoing mini split cooling problems.
What Causes A Coil To Freeze
Coils freeze when the coil temperature drops too low and moisture in the air freezes on contact. The most common reason is low airflow. Another reason is low refrigerant pressure caused by a leak. Either way, the result is the same: ice buildup blocks airflow and cooling performance collapses.
Signs Of Coil Icing
- Weak airflow
- Water dripping after thaw
- Cooling works briefly then stops
- Ice visible on coil or piping
What To Do If You Find Ice
Turn cooling off and set fan mode to thaw. Check filters and airflow. Do not keep running cooling with ice present. If the unit freezes again, schedule service. A professional can identify whether airflow or refrigerant issues are driving mini split cooling problems.
Refrigerant Issues And Leaks
Refrigerant does not get used up. If your system is low, it usually means there is a leak. Low refrigerant can cause weak cooling, icing, long runtimes, and inconsistent operation. These are classic mini split cooling problems that require professional diagnosis.
A technician will check pressures, temperatures, and system performance, then locate and repair leaks before recharging. Simply adding refrigerant without repairing the leak is not a long term solution. If you suspect refrigerant issues, the safest approach is to stop DIY troubleshooting and schedule service.
Symptoms That Suggest Low Refrigerant
- Cooling slowly worsens over weeks or months
- Indoor coil icing persists despite clean filters
- Hissing or bubbling sounds near line connections
- The system runs long but never reaches set temperature
Why Refrigerant Repairs Must Be Professional
Refrigerant handling requires proper tools and certification. It also requires following regulations that protect safety and the environment. Control, Sensor, And Thermostat Related Issues
Mini splits often use built in sensors to measure room temperature. If the sensor is affected by sunlight, electronics heat, or poor air mixing, the unit may misread the room and reduce output early. That can create mini split cooling problems where the room stays warm even though the unit appears to be running.
Sensor issues are common in bedrooms with heavy curtains or in rooms where the indoor unit is placed near a TV, lamp, or warm appliance. Better airflow, different fan settings, and repositioned obstacles can help. If the system has advanced controls, adjustments may also improve accuracy.
Temperature Sensing And Room Mixing
The indoor unit needs good air mixing to sense room temperature accurately. If cool air stays near the unit and warm air stays across the room, the unit may think the room is already cool. That leads to mini split cooling problems that feel like weak performance. Using Auto fan, enabling swing, and keeping doors open when appropriate can improve mixing.
Remote Control Problems
Remote control issues also create mini split cooling problems. Low batteries can cause commands to fail or send partial settings. If cooling behavior seems inconsistent, replace remote batteries and confirm the display shows the correct mode and set temperature.
Drain And Moisture Issues That Trigger Shutdowns
A clogged drain line can cause water buildup and sometimes trigger a safety shutdown. In high humidity weather, mini splits produce more condensate. If the drain is partially blocked, you may see dripping water indoors, musty smells, or intermittent shutdowns. These can be mini split cooling problems that appear as weak cooling because the system stops before it can do its job.
If you notice water leakage, turn the unit off and inspect the area. Some minor clogs can be cleared, but if you are unsure, professional service is safer. Water damage can be expensive, and persistent drain issues often require proper cleaning and inspection.
Signs You May Have A Drain Issue
- Water dripping from the indoor unit
- Musty odor near the unit
- Cooling stops and error codes appear
- Problems worsen during humid days
Mini Split Cooling Problems People Miss
Many homeowners check the obvious things and still miss simple causes. This random list highlights issues that frequently lead to mini split cooling problems even when the system is otherwise healthy.
- Unit left in Dry mode instead of Cool mode
- Set temperature too close to room temperature
- Remote batteries weak and commands not applied
- Filters look clean but are clogged with fine dust
- Outdoor unit blocked by weeds or stored items
- Curtains covering the indoor intake
- Indoor coil beginning to ice due to airflow restriction
- Multiple zones competing for capacity on a multi zone system
How To Prevent Future Cooling Problems
Once you fix the immediate issue, prevention is the next step. Many mini split cooling problems repeat because filters are not cleaned regularly, outdoor units are not kept clear, or the system is not maintained before the hottest months. Simple routines reduce breakdown risk and improve efficiency.
If you have a multi zone system, consider how you use zones. Avoid extreme setpoints in one room that force the system to prioritize that zone. Use reasonable setpoints and let the inverter system modulate. For long term stability, schedule periodic checkups to catch airflow, coil, and drain issues before they become mini split cooling problems.
Maintenance Habits That Matter
- Clean filters on a regular schedule
- Keep outdoor unit clear of debris
- Check airflow and remove obstructions
- Do not block indoor units with furniture or curtains
- Schedule professional maintenance when performance drops
